About Us

Located 35km to the southeast of Melbourne, Greater Dandenong City Council covers 129 square kilometres and has a population of over 169,000 people. The central activities district is Melbourne's second largest retail and commercial centre and includes large shopping complexes at Dandenong and Keysborough as well as the highly popular Dandenong Market.

Greater Dandenong City Council is the most culturally diverse locality in Australia, with residents from over 150 different birthplaces, nearly two-thirds of whom were born overseas. Key industries include manufacturing, health care and social assistance, retail trade, wholesale trade and transport.

About the role

This field-based position sits within council’s Waste & Cleansing Services team. The role will be responsible for multiple disciplines across both areas.

The key responsibilities include but not limited to:

· Operating Heavy Rigid Plant

· Staff supervision & early morning roster changes (7 days per week program)

· Random contract inspections

· Quality & Safety auditing

· Purchasing (consumables)

· Troubleshooting & Team support

· Reporting

· Other duties as required by Foreperson Cleansing Services.

About you

To be successful in this role, you will have:

· Completion of TAFE accredited/industry-based training courses. (Cert 111 or Cert 1V) as well as a minimum of a post-trades certificate (e.g. special class trades) or Relevant/equivalent experience.

· Current Heavy Rigid drivers licence.

· Skills in staff management, work allocation, productivity and quality monitoring preferably with a good understanding of Council work practices, responsibilities and corporate standards.

· Good communication and interpersonal skills including the ability to advise and liaise.

· Proven ability in planning work according to established priorities in a multi-disciplinary environment.

· Knowledge of safe plant operation techniques for all cleansing plant and equipment.

· Ability to work diligently and enthusiastically without supervision.

· Computer literacy basic or better
